Type
ORACLE
Validation date
2024-08-01 08:28: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01879,
    "usd": 0.02033
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001EB4F59989C907F28BDAD377C640EB81A883304E2395EDFB024E5B257588E7ED9

Previous signature

B7F8A642367C449AEBC9446D96AC5D87BA8663A5AB6493DC8948044006FBB7930BBE1010B3DB024F09A6B1149442E549578B9D28C68B33A7BEB130C11C2FE20D

Origin signature

30450220054F6907779D091976103112D055906D57D614F6402B659B781A3CF6C302E066022100D0965AD364FDC011DDE29AA8235F83232DB639D028C9B617D5C60609634C2853

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

00852D44F8A417FF124CCD08C1535D717149CAE3EB78BA7ADA95B7A126C2560DF1

Coordinator signature

FCE9DD2B4306BA9DF0FD5ED2CB3A9D667F2D2E95DB2FE558B83BD876E54795C45CB07464B8BA14E0BFF511C7AE920F6955FE36A8BBEBD2A0B0C8C8E8D4472F08

Validator #1 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#1 signature

C7A717BB8A5255B5A7707FC60C3B474ADE48AC00A4D3BB0EDC64A9B4A3AD6E9C299F5B64A8252414BA445AEBC365A683CBEBD963AF57CD89136DED4CF8AF670A

Validator #2 public key

0001F6081DDC1AC8BCE9CC8727A38B5A8A449BA45DFD746D0FD412006309825D0D79

Validator #2 signature

2D5137BA4CDADAAA44C7A7ECE6F7D5B3C1D4E3FF4BAE672D873EEE50DAE6677DB8C36B094C2AE56BF9455BB483F71CCA3912CAA11A2F90CD83C9C47A53C55A0F